Acquisite

/ˈækwɪzɪt/ adjective

Definition

Archaic or obsolete term meaning acquired or suitable for acquisition; of fine quality.

Etymology

From Latin acquisitus (past participle of acquirere); related to 'exquisite' (ex- meaning out + quisitus meaning sought), sharing the same Latin root.

Kelly Says

Acquisite is basically a linguistic ghost—'exquisite' stole its thunder by using the same Latin root with a different prefix. It's like the overlooked sibling of a famous word.
